McCormick Apartments (National Trust for Historic - View this location on map

Among the city's most elaborate luxury apartment houses; residence from 1922-37 of millionaire industrialist, Secretary of the Treasury (from 1921-32, the longest cabinet tenure since Albert Gallatin), and author of the 'Mellon Plan' which stimulated the economic boom of the 1920s; built 1915-16, J.H. de Sibour, architect
1785 Massachusetts Avenue, NW, Washington , DC
